Ricard Vila studied at the Elisava School of Design. Before setting up his own studio in Igualada in 1999, he worked for Rucker, Manel Ybargüengoitia and Lievore, as well as Altherr and Molina. In 2001 he founded Calot Works S.L., specialising in interior design, commercial premises, restaurants and temporary installations. In 2008 he moved his studio to Espais del Rec, a former leather tannery dating back to the 18th century, a space he shared with various creative studios. A year later, he set up the firm Rec.0 which designs pop-up stores for radical selling. He is currently involved in product, furniture and interior design projects for brands such as DO + CE, Dd, TKT brainpower, Stilus, Criber, Alis-Mooa, Bandalux, Artesanía Catalunya, AB industries, as well as other projects in the development phase.
